We are currently recruiting for a skilled Water Hygiene Engineer to join a dynamic and growing team within the Water Treatment sector. If you have experience in water hygiene, including monitoring, testing and maintenance and you're looking for a rewarding new challenge, my client wants to hear from you!
Role Overview: As a Water Hygiene Engineer, you'll play a crucial role in ensuring compliance with water safety regulations and carrying out essential maintenance and testing on water systems across a variety of sites. Your expertise will help safeguard public health by preventing waterborne illnesses and ensuring that all systems meet health and safety standards.
Key Responsibilities:
- Conduct routine water hygiene testing and sampling on various water systems.
- Carry out system disinfection, cleaning and maintenance.
- Complete Legionella monitoring, and temperature checks.
- Prepare accurate reports and maintain detailed records.
- Ensure compliance with all relevant legislation and regulations.
- Build and maintain strong client relationships, offering exceptional service at all times.
Skills & Experience:
- Previous experience in a similar role within water hygiene or water treatment.
- Knowledge of HSG274, ACoP L8 and other related water hygiene regulations.
- Ability to perform water system cleaning, disinfection and sampling on domestic hot & cold water systems.
- Strong attention to detail, with excellent communication and reporting skills.
- Full UK driving licence (essential).
